Download Solution PDFPositive Clipper:
- A positive clipper circuit is used to clip off the positive part of the input signal voltage above a certain level while allowing the rest of the waveform to pass through unchanged.
- It generally consists of a diode and a resistor. The diode is connected in series with the input signal, and the resistor is usually connected in parallel with the diode.
- When the input signal is greater than the forward voltage of the diode, the diode conducts and clips the signal at that voltage level.
- If the input signal is less than the forward voltage of the diode, the diode remains off, and the signal passes through unchanged.
- This type of circuit is useful in waveform shaping, signal conditioning, and protecting circuits from voltage spikes.
